Abstract
Smart home systems continue to become smarter, more scenario oriented and interconnected. These systems have been made possible through the integration of artificial intelligence technology which allows them to be more efficiently automated controlled and intelligently regulated. With the help of smart sensing and data analysis and machine learning algorithms, the system may adaptively change the state of operation of different devices in response to the user requirements and environmental conditions. This optimization method uses machine learning algorithms and multimodal data analysis to optimize inter-device cooperation, ease user actions, and increase system reaction rates and energy usage. The experimental validation findings indicate that the given method greatly contributes to the improvement of system intelligence, enhanced user experience, and optimized energy management. Enhanced smart home system is not only enhancing lifestyle but also offering fresh perspectives and technical assistance to the future progress of the smart home market.
